Replacing Lost Car Keys

The loss of your car keys can be extremely frustrating. It is especially frustrating when you are in a rush and have to get to work.

There are many places you can go to replace your car keys. However, you will need to provide some information to ensure that the process is completed in the most efficient way possible.

2. Contact your dealer

It can be a hassle to lose your car keys. It's not something people prepare for. emergency car key replacement of people don't even realize they've lost their car key until it is too late.

They will then begin looking for the keys and may have to be very persistent. It is crucial to look for other alternatives to replace a car key in case you can't find it.

One option that can save you time and money is to call your dealership to request a new key. They will usually cut and program keys for half the cost of a locksmith.

In the majority of instances, dealers can get a key in an hour or two. They can also offer assistance at the roadside in the event you require assistance in getting your vehicle to the dealership.

Before contacting your dealer you'll need to gather some important information about your vehicle. The first step is to record the VIN (vehicle identification number). This will help the dealership identify your car and make sure they have an appropriate key for the model you have.

Check to see whether your insurance policy or car warranty covers key replacement. Bring your car along with a photo ID and any other keys you own to the dealership so they can replace the key.

After you have received a new key, you'll be required to program it into your vehicle. Although most dealerships will provide a programer, it is best to follow the instructions in the manual you received.

Before you go to the hardware store, be sure you record your vehicle's VIN number. This number is usually found on the driver side doorpost or stamped on a steel plate that is located on the dashboard. This number will allow the locksmith to match the right keys with your vehicle and ensure that they work correctly.

A replacement key can cost between $50 and $500 depending on the kind of car and the insurance company you have with you. This includes both the cost of the key and the cost of having it reprogrammed to your vehicle.
